3. In order to win the grand prize, Benny has to crack this secret code. Given the clues, help
Ben to crack the code.
83
65
(a) The third digit is greater than the second digit.
(b) The difference is 3 when the third digit is subtracted from the fourth one.
(c) When the sum of all the numbers is divided by 5, it has a remainder of 3.
(d) When the sum of all the numbers is divided by 6, it also has a remainder of 3.
4. Ten people can sit around a rectangular table for a meal. When two such tables are
joined side by side, 18 people can sit around the two tables. When three such tables are
joined sided by side, 26 people can sit around the three tables. How many such rectangular
tables are needed for 90 people to sit together?
